The Odessa National Maritime
Academy is well-known for a long time in the world of marine
shipping thanks to its 40000 highly qualified specialists,
its graduates, who work in hundreds of shipping companies
all over the world.
With every oncoming year more
and more shipping owners of Great Britain, Greece, Germany,
the Netherlands and other European countries give preference
to the graduates of our Academy.
About 8000 cadets and
students study at Odessa National Maritime Academy (ONMA).
The annual graduation is about 1000 specialists.
The Academy was accredited by
the State Accreditation Board of Ukraine with accreditation
level IV (the highest). The specialities of automation,
ships' engineering, electromechanical and radio-electronic
faculties were accredited by the Institute of Marine
Engineering, Science and Technology of Great Britain (IMarEST)
with the "charter engineer", - the highest level, and the
faculty of Navigation was accredited by the Nautical
Institute of Great Britain (NI).
The studies are carried out
according to the graded system. The terms of studies are the
following: four years for bachelor, five and a half years
for specialist and master. The system of ship's crew
training is in compliance with the requirements of the
International Convention of Training, Certification and
Watchkeeping for Seafarers (STCW -78/ 95) and other
international conventions which give graduates the right to
work on all types of vessels of native and foreign
companies.

1.Sea Navigation Faculty:
Speciality:
"Navigation"
Specialization:
"Deep-Sea Navigation",
"Cargo transportation, Chartering and Agency Service"
After
four years of studies a cadet is granted a bachelor's degree
(diploma), an international certificate of competency and
all necessary certificates, required for performing the
duties of officer in charge of a navigational watch.
Graduates having bachelor's degree may go on with their
studies up to the level of a specialist or a master. The
term of studies is 1.5 years. The certificate of specialist
or master allows professional growth up to the rank of deep
sea captain.
The
graduates of the faculty successfully work both on board
sea-going ships and in many branches of the industry, as
well as at many management positions.

4.Electrical Engineering and Radio Electronics Faculty:
Speciality:
"Electric Systems and Complexes of Transport Means", "Radioelectronic
Appliances, Systems and Complexes"
Specialization:
"Operation and Maintenance of Ship's Automated Systems";
Training standards of specialists in "Electrical Systems and
Complexes of Transport Means" take into account the growth
of ships' power equipment, increase of the number of
electrically-propelled ships, modern evolution level of
electric automatics and computerized control technologies.
Graduates of this speciality are wide profile ships
specialists. They are able to operate effectively not only
electrical equipment and automatic systems, but also a ship
power plant.
The graduates get the "III class electrician" certificate
and international certificate of officer in charge of an
engineering watch according to the STCW Code Requirements.
Training standards of specialists in "Radioelectronic
Devices, Systems and Complexes" meet the requirements of
modern progress in radioelectronics, terrestrial and
satellite communication and navigation systems, computer
techniques. Cadets obtain thorough knowledge in modern
digital communication technology, wireless land area
networks (WLAN) and mobile communication.
The graduates get international Radioelectronic's
certificate according to the STCW Code Requirements. The
Faculty possesses modern simulator facilities, on which the
cadets undergo their training
The graduates majoring in their specific fields are employed
on vessels as marine engineers, electrical engineers and
radio engineers.
They also work at ship-repairing yards and for shipping
companies, in on-shore radio centers, ports, scientific
research institutes, telecommunication companies, designing
organizations, higher educational establishments.
